MySQL 前三日简介
介绍
MySQL是一种开源的关系型数据库管理系统,被广泛应用于Web应用程序和其他许多类型的软件开发中。MySQL以其高性能、可靠性和易用性而闻名,是最流行的数据库之一。
在本文中,我们将探讨MySQL的前三日,包括MySQL的基本概念,如何安装MySQL,以及如何使用MySQL进行常见的数据库操作。
MySQL基础知识
数据库
数据库是一种用于存储和组织数据的结构化方式。MySQL是一种关系型数据库,其中数据以表的形式存储,并且表之间可以建立关系。
表
表是MySQL中存储数据的基本单位。每个表由一组列和行组成。每个列代表一种数据类型,而每一行则代表一个记录。
列和数据类型
MySQL支持多种数据类型,包括整数、浮点数、字符串、日期和时间等。在创建表时,您需要定义每个列的数据类型。
主键
主键用于唯一标识表中的每一行。通常,主键是一个自增的整数列,确保每一行都有一个唯一的标识符。
安装MySQL
在开始使用MySQL之前,您需要安装MySQL服务器和MySQL客户端。以下是在不同操作系统上安装MySQL的步骤:
Windows
- 访问MySQL官方网站,并下载最新的MySQL安装程序。
- 双击安装程序,按照安装向导的指示进行安装。
- 安装完成后,打开命令提示符窗口,输入
mysql -u root -p
以登录MySQL。
macOS
- 打开终端应用程序,并使用Homebrew包管理器安装MySQL,输入
brew install mysql
。 - 安装完成后,输入
mysql -u root -p
以登录MySQL。
Linux
- 打开终端应用程序,并使用适用于您的Linux发行版的包管理器安装MySQL。
- 安装完成后,输入
mysql -u root -p
以登录MySQL。
MySQL常见操作
创建数据库
要创建一个新的数据库,您可以使用CREATE DATABASE
语句,后面加上数据库的名称。以下是一个示例:
CREATE DATABASE mydatabase;
创建表
要创建一个新的表,您可以使用CREATE TABLE
语句,后面加上表的名称和列的定义。以下是一个示例:
CREATE TABLE mytable (
id INT PRIMARY KEY AUTO_INCREMENT,
name VARCHAR(50),
age INT
);
插入数据
要将数据插入表中,您可以使用INSERT INTO
语句,后面加上表的名称和要插入的值。以下是一个示例:
INSERT INTO mytable (name, age) VALUES ('John', 25);
查询数据
要从表中检索数据,您可以使用SELECT
语句,后面加上要检索的列和表的名称。以下是一个示例:
SELECT name, age FROM mytable;
更新数据
要更新表中的数据,您可以使用UPDATE
语句,后面加上要更新的列和新值的定义。以下是一个示例:
UPDATE mytable SET age = 30 WHERE id = 1;
删除数据
要从表中删除数据,您可以使用DELETE FROM
语句,后面加上要删除的行的条件。以下是一个示例:
DELETE FROM mytable WHERE id = 1;
MySQL的前三日总结
在本文中,我们了解了MySQL的基本概念,包括数据库、表、列和数据类型。我们还学习了如何安装MySQL,并进行了一些常见的MySQL操作,如创建数据库、创建表、插入数据、查询数据、更新数据和删除数据。
MySQL作为一种功能强大而灵活的数据库管理系统,可以满足各种不同的应用需求。通过学习和掌握MySQL的基础知识和常见操作,您将能够更好地利用MySQL来管理和操作数据。
希望本文对您的MySQL学习